A OneNote konvertálása Typora Markdown-ra

Lépésről lépésre Útmutató a .NET-hez A OneNote konvertálása Typora formátumba C# nyelven

 

A OneNote (.one) konvertálása Typora-kompatibilis jelöléssé

A Microsoft OneNote egy hatékony eszköz a jegyzetek szabadalmazott .one formátumban történő rendezésére és tárolására. A Markdown azonban egyszerűséget és kompatibilitást kínál az olyan szerkesztőkkel, mint a Typora, így kiváló választás az egyszerűsített, platformfüggetlen jegyzetkészítéshez. Ez az útmutató bemutatja, hogyan konvertálhat .one fájlokat Markdown formátumba Typora számára az Aspose.Note for .NET és az Aspose.Html for .NET használatával.

Kódpélda: OneNote a Typora Markdownhoz

Íme egy minta C# kódrészlet, amely bemutatja a teljes konverziós folyamatot:

    using Aspose.Html;
    using Aspose.Html.Converters;
    using Aspose.Note;
    using System.IO;

    public void ConvertOneNoteToTypora()
    {
        string oneFilePath = "path/to/your/onenote-file.one"; // Path to OneNote file
        string mdFilePath = "path/to/output-file.md";         // Output markdown file

        using (var ms = new MemoryStream())
        {
            // Step 1: Load the OneNote document and save it as HTML
            Document document = new Document(oneFilePath);
            document.Save(ms, SaveFormat.Html);
            ms.Position = 0;

            // Step 2: Load the HTML from memory stream and convert it to Markdown
            HTMLDocument htmlDocument = new HTMLDocument(ms, "temp.html");
            MarkdownSaveOptions options = new MarkdownSaveOptions();
            Converter.ConvertHTML(htmlDocument, options, mdFilePath);
        }
    }

A .one fájlok Typora-kompatibilis Markdown formátumba konvertálásához C# nyelven kövesse az alábbi lépéseket:
1. Exportálja a OneNote-ot HTML formátumba: Az Aspose.Note for .NET segítségével konvertálja .one fájlját HTML formátumba.
2. Konvertálja a HTML-t Markdown-ra: Használja ki az Aspose.Html-t a .NET-hez, hogy a HTML-fájlt Markdown- (.md)-vé alakítsa, miközben megtartja a formázást és a szerkezetet.

Ez a kód a OneNote (.one) fájlokat Markdown (.md) fájllá alakítja, amely kompatibilis olyan szerkesztőkkel, mint a Typora. Először az Aspose.Note for .NET segítségével tölti be a .one fájlt, és mentse el tartalmát HTML-ként egy memóriafolyamban. Ezután az Aspose.Html for .NET segítségével tölti be a HTML-kódot az adatfolyamból, és Markdown fájllá alakítja, megőrizve a szerkezetet és a formázást. Ez a kétlépéses folyamat biztosítja, hogy a OneNote-tartalom pontosan egy könnyű, hordozható Markdown formátummá alakuljon át.

Miért konvertálja a OneNote-ot Typora Markdown-ra?

A .one formátum a fejlett jegyzetelés terén jeleskedik, és olyan funkciókat kínál, mint a multimédiás támogatás és a felhőintegráció. Eközben a Markdown könnyű, hordozható, és széles körben támogatott olyan eszközökön, mint a Typora. A OneNote-fájlok Markdown-ba konvertálása lehetővé teszi a strukturált tartalom fenntartását, miközben lehetővé teszi a minimalista és zavaró szerkesztési környezetet. Emiatt a Markdown ideális a rugalmasságot, a platformok közötti kompatibilitást és a hatékony szövegkezelést kereső felhasználók számára.

 

A Markdown formátumról

A Markdown egy könnyű jelölőnyelv, amelyet formázott szöveg egyszerű szintaxissal történő létrehozására terveztek. Elsődleges hangsúlya az olvashatóságon és a könnyű használaton van, nyers és renderelt formában egyaránt. A Markdown platformfüggetlensége ideálissá teszi azokat a felhasználókat, akik rugalmasságot és kompatibilitást igényelnek a különféle eszközökkel, köztük a Typorával, egy népszerű Markdown-szerkesztővel. A címsorok, listák, hivatkozások és egyebek támogatásával a Markdown lehetővé teszi a felhasználók számára, hogy minimális erőfeszítéssel strukturált és stílusos tartalmat hozzanak létre. A fejlesztők, írók és jegyzetelők által kedvelt formátumként a Markdown hatékony tartalomkészítést és szerkesztést biztosít, miközben fenntartja a platformok közötti használhatóságot.

A OneNote (.one) fájlokról

A OneNote (.one) fájlok a Microsoft OneNote, egy hatékony digitális jegyzetfüzet alkalmazás által használt szabadalmaztatott formátum. Ezek a fájlok lehetővé teszik a felhasználók számára, hogy feljegyzéseket, képeket, rajzokat és multimédiát rendezzenek rugalmas, kereshető és megosztható formátumban. A beépített felhőszinkronizálással a OneNote hozzáférést biztosít az eszközök között, így személyes és professzionális használatra egyaránt kedvencévé válik. A Microsoft Office-szal való integrációja és az együttműködési funkciók támogatása a .one fájlokat sokoldalú választássá teszi az információk hatékony kezeléséhez és megosztásához.

Az Aspose.Note és az Aspose.HTML konvertáláshoz való használatának előnyei

Az Aspose.Note for .NET és az Aspose.Html for .NET használatával zökkenőmentesen konvertálhatja a OneNote fájlokat Typora Markdown for .NET-re. Ez a megoldás biztosítja, hogy a jegyzetei kompatibilisek legyenek a Markdown-alapú eszközökkel, megőrizve azok szerkezetét és tartalmát.

Have a Questions, Comments, Suggestions Write Us!

  Write Us

Egyéb támogatott OneNote-konverziók .NET-en keresztül

A OneNote-dokumentumot számos más fájlformátumra is konvertálhatja:

HTML TO ONE (HyperText Markup Language)
ONE TO BMP (Bitmap Image File)
ONE TO GIF (Graphic Image File)
ONE TO JPEG (JPEG Image)
ONE TO PDF (Portable Document Format)
ONE TO PNG (Portable Network Graphics)
ONE TO TIFF (Tagged Image File Format)
ONE TO NOTION (Rich Text Database Format.)
ONE TO OBSIDIAN (OneNote Section File Format.)
EVERNOTE TO ONE (Evernote Note Export Format.)
OBSIDIAN TO ONE (Markdown Plain Text File Format.)
ONE TO NOTABLE (Notable Markdown File Format.)
ONE TO ZETTLR (Zettlr Markdown File Format.)
ONE TO JOPLIN (Joplin Markdown File Format.)
ONE TO TYPORA (Typora Markdown File Format.)
ONE TO MARKDOWN (Generic Markdown File Format.)
ONE TO HTML (HyperText Markup Language.)
PDF TO ONE (Portable Document Format)
MARKDOWN TO ONE (Markdown Plain Text File Format.)
HTML TO ONE Import (HyperText Markup Language Using String Method)